Comcast, the media conglomerate owning NBCUniversal, did not specify what’s deemed as policy breaking misconduct.
However, Shell himself admitted to having an “inappropriate relationship with a woman in the company.” Comcast released a statement expressing its disappointment with Shell’s conduct and emphasized its commitment to creating a safe and respectful workplace. Shell also released a statement, apologizing for his conduct and expressing regret that he had let down his colleagues.
The news comes at an especially challenging time for NBCUniversal. The company is attempting to grow its Peacock Streaming service while also facing declining ratings in traditional television and uncertainty about the future of movie theaters.
